The well-known network insider Digital Chat Station has released details of the plans of the Chinese giant Huawei to use single-chip systems in its smartphones.
The source claims that stocks of Kirin SoCs are already depleted, so most of the models to be released in the first half of next year will be powered by Qualcomm Snapdragon SoCs. Digital Chat Station adds that Huawei will soon introduce another smartphone based on the Kirin 9000 4G mobile platform.

Recently, Huawei P50 series smartphones appeared on the shelves with a Snapdragon 888 single-chip system and a 4G modem. The company also launched the Huawei nova 9 series with the Snapdragon 778G 4G mobile platform. Huawei can only use single-chip 4G systems due to US sanctions.
Digital Chat Station was the first to accurately report the specifications and release dates of the Redmi K30, K40, Xiaomi Mi 10 and Mi 11.
